写点什么

避坑指南|监控宝网站监控的常见问题及解决方法

  • 2023-02-17
    北京
  • 本文字数:921 字

    阅读完需:约 3 分钟

避坑指南|监控宝网站监控的常见问题及解决方法

作者:云智慧开发经理 Lina Ma

监控宝的网站监控通过全球分布式监测点对用户的网站实现分布式监控,包括网络稳定性、服务端口可用性、网络路由稳定性、DNS 解析正确性等,从而快速发现和解决问题。


点击直达监控宝官网

通过浏览器访问网站正常,监控宝返回不可用,可能是什么原因?

1、网站并发能力不足
  • 出现原因:每个频率,各区域监测点会同时发起探测,如果选择了 100+甚至 200+个监测点,而网站本身并发能力不好,会出现无法访问的情况。可将监测点个数降低到 10 个以内观察数据。

  • 解决方法:通过使用 CDN 加速、缓存、增加服务器节点、优化网站程序等方式,提升网站的并发能力。

2、网站使用的 CDN 在某区域有问题
  • 出现原因:相关域名在 CDN 服务商的某地区未同步或未更新,可在该地区对指定域名进行解析,可查看、分析域名解析结果。

  • 解决方法:联系 CDN 服务商进行排查。

3、个别监测点出现不可用
  • 出现原因:可能是监测点和网站所在服务器的网络通讯有问题。

  • 解决方法: 可开启 mtr 探测,对路由追踪结果进行检查。

4、个别监测点偶尔出现连接被重置的情况
  • 出现原因: 由于服务端网络结构中(反向代理、负载均衡等)设置的 TCP 连接的超时时间不一致,如果某次请求在服务端业务处理和响应的时间略长,而服务端网络结构中某一处可能会出现 TCP 连接的超时,这就会导致客户端正在接收数据的连接被提前中断,客户端获取响应失败。

  • 解决方法: 调整服务端网络结构中的 TCP 连接设置,比如:统一使用长连接或短连接、统一 TCP 连接的超时时间。

5、网站使用了 301/302 重定向
  • 出现原因: 如下图,域名进行了 301 转发,在监控宝却没有进行对应设置。


  • 解决方法: 在监控宝任务设置中,勾选重定向开关,如图


6、已经按问题 5 的方式设置了重定向,依然不可用
  • 问题原因: 可能是网站内部使用 Js 等方式进行重定向,监控宝主要从网络方面进行连通性探测,并不会执行内部程序。

  • 解决方法: 建议使用 301/302 重定向方式。

7、SSL 证书设置不当
  • 问题原因: 任务开启了 SSL 证书验证,但是证书版本选择有误。

  • 解决方法: 通过浏览器或者从证书提供方获取证书版本,在监控宝进行对应设置,如图


8、网站程序对请求参数有验证
  • 问题原因: 比如,程序内部要求必须有使用指定的 User-Agent。

  • 解决方法: 在监控宝任务设置中进行参数设置,如图



点击直达监控宝官网

发布于: 刚刚阅读数: 5
用户头像

全栈智能业务运维服务商 2021-03-10 加入

我们秉承Make Digital Online的使命,致力于通过先进的产品技术,为企业数字化转型和提升IT运营效率持续赋能。 https://www.cloudwise.com/

评论

发布
暂无评论
避坑指南|监控宝网站监控的常见问题及解决方法_监控_云智慧AIOps社区_InfoQ写作社区